You can’t replace the in-gym experience with a personal trainer, but Wello is a company that is trying to come close through the power of the Internet. They’re based in Palo Alto, CA, and they offer personal trainers over “live, 2-way video.”
As my trainer says, “a good trainer can train someone in four foot by four foot space.” Having access to a gym with all kinds of equipment is nice, but it’s not essential. Wello allows you to get an amazing workout in whatever space you have available whether it’s a hotel room or your bedroom. And you still get most of the benefits of having an in-person trainer–form checks, getting pushed to your limit, and a program tailored to your needs. There’s obviously something that will be lost through the video connection, but I’m sure that it’s more about your attitude than anything else. You can get a feel for how Wello works here.
